Good to know
Are antique stores open on Sundays?
Many are, especially in tourist or weekend-shopping areas, but it's far from universal — a good share of independent antique dealers close Sunday and Monday and open midweek instead. Antique malls with multiple vendors under one roof are generally more likely to keep consistent weekend hours than single-owner shops.
What time do antique stores usually close on Sunday?
Sunday hours tend to run shorter than the rest of the week, commonly closing sometime in the mid-to-late afternoon rather than staying open into the evening. Exact closing time varies a lot by shop, so it's worth confirming directly rather than assuming a standard retail schedule.
